Miramar: The Goa government on Saturday paid rich tributes to former chief minister Manohar Parrikar on his birth anniversary, with leaders including Chief Minister Pramod Sawant remembering the departed leader.

The chief minister was accompanied by Union Minister Naik, BJP Goa President Damodar Naik, and others. The family members of Parrikar, including both his sons — Utpal and Abhijat — were present at the memorial at Miramar Beach.

“Goa will always remember Parrikar for the developmental works undertaken during his tenure. He was a visionary leader,” Sawant told reporters.

He said that his government has been carrying forward the vision of Parrikar through various developmental projects. Sawant added that infrastructure and human development were the focus of Parrikar during his governance.

The chief minister said that the state will always remember Parrikar.

BJP Goa President Damodar Naik said that Parrikar was instrumental in launching several social welfare schemes that provided much-needed relief to the poor and needy in the state.

He added that the subsequent BJP government has continued these schemes, improving them further and realizing the vision of Parrikar.
